Sunday, February 1, 2026
  • Login
SB Crypto Guru News- latest crypto news, NFTs, DEFI, Web3, Metaverse
No Result
View All Result
  • HOME
  • BITCOIN
  • CRYPTO UPDATES
    • GENERAL
    • ALTCOINS
    • ETHEREUM
    • CRYPTO EXCHANGES
    • CRYPTO MINING
  • BLOCKCHAIN
  • NFT
  • DEFI
  • WEB3
  • METAVERSE
  • REGULATIONS
  • SCAM ALERT
  • ANALYSIS
CRYPTO MARKETCAP
  • HOME
  • BITCOIN
  • CRYPTO UPDATES
    • GENERAL
    • ALTCOINS
    • ETHEREUM
    • CRYPTO EXCHANGES
    • CRYPTO MINING
  • BLOCKCHAIN
  • NFT
  • DEFI
  • WEB3
  • METAVERSE
  • REGULATIONS
  • SCAM ALERT
  • ANALYSIS
No Result
View All Result
SB Crypto Guru News- latest crypto news, NFTs, DEFI, Web3, Metaverse
No Result
View All Result

NVIDIA Unveils NCCL 2.22 with Enhanced Memory Efficiency and Faster Initialization

by SB Crypto Guru News
September 21, 2024
in Blockchain
Reading Time: 3 mins read
0 0
A A
0




Caroline Bishop
Sep 21, 2024 13:38

NVIDIA introduces NCCL 2.22, focusing on memory efficiency, faster initialization, and cost estimation for improved HPC and AI applications.



NVIDIA Unveils NCCL 2.22 with Enhanced Memory Efficiency and Faster Initialization

The NVIDIA Collective Communications Library (NCCL) has released its latest version, NCCL 2.22, bringing significant enhancements aimed at optimizing memory usage, accelerating initialization times, and introducing a cost estimation API. These updates are crucial for high-performance computing (HPC) and artificial intelligence (AI) applications, according to the NVIDIA Technical Blog.

Release Highlights

NVIDIA Magnum IO NCCL is designed to optimize inter-GPU and multi-node communication, which is essential for efficient parallel computing. Key features of the NCCL 2.22 release include:

  • Lazy Connection Establishment: This feature delays the creation of connections until they are needed, significantly reducing GPU memory overhead.
  • New API for Cost Estimation: A new API helps optimize compute and communication overlap or research the NCCL cost model.
  • Optimizations for ncclCommInitRank: Redundant topology queries are eliminated, speeding up initialization by up to 90% for applications creating multiple communicators.
  • Support for Multiple Subnets with IB Router: Adds support for communication in jobs spanning multiple InfiniBand subnets, enabling larger DL training jobs.

Features in Detail

Lazy Connection Establishment

NCCL 2.22 introduces lazy connection establishment, which significantly reduces GPU memory usage by delaying the creation of connections until they are actually needed. This feature is particularly beneficial for applications that use a narrow scope, such as running the same algorithm repeatedly. The feature is enabled by default but can be disabled by setting NCCL_RUNTIME_CONNECT=0.

New Cost Model API

The new API, ncclGroupSimulateEnd, allows developers to estimate the time required for operations, aiding in the optimization of compute and communication overlap. While the estimates may not perfectly align with reality, they provide a useful guideline for performance tuning.

Initialization Optimizations

To minimize initialization overhead, the NCCL team has introduced several optimizations, including lazy connection establishment and intra-node topology fusion. These improvements can reduce ncclCommInitRank execution time by up to 90%, making it significantly faster for applications that create multiple communicators.

New Tuner Plugin Interface

The new tuner plugin interface (v3) provides a per-collective 2D cost table, reporting the estimated time needed for operations. This allows external tuners to optimize algorithm and protocol combinations for better performance.

Static Plugin Linking

For convenience and to avoid loading issues, NCCL 2.22 supports static linking of network or tuner plugins. Applications can specify this by setting NCCL_NET_PLUGIN or NCCL_TUNER_PLUGIN to STATIC_PLUGIN.

Group Semantics for Abort or Destroy

NCCL 2.22 introduces group semantics for ncclCommDestroy and ncclCommAbort, allowing multiple communicators to be destroyed simultaneously. This feature aims to prevent deadlocks and improve user experience.

IB Router Support

With this release, NCCL can operate across different InfiniBand subnets, enhancing communication for larger networks. The library automatically detects and establishes connections between endpoints on different subnets, using FLID for higher performance and adaptive routing.

Bug Fixes and Minor Updates

The NCCL 2.22 release also includes several bug fixes and minor updates:

  • Support for the allreduce tree algorithm on DGX Google Cloud.
  • Logging of NIC names in IB async errors.
  • Improved performance of registered send and receive operations.
  • Added infrastructure code for NVIDIA Trusted Computing Solutions.
  • Separate traffic class for IB and RoCE control messages to enable advanced QoS.
  • Support for PCI peer-to-peer communications across partitioned Broadcom PCI switches.

Summary

The NCCL 2.22 release introduces several significant features and optimizations aimed at improving performance and efficiency for HPC and AI applications. The improvements include a new tuner plugin interface, support for static linking of plugins, and enhanced group semantics to prevent deadlocks.

Image source: Shutterstock




Source link

Tags: Bitcoin NewsCrypto NewsCrypto UpdatesefficiencyEnhancedFasterInitializationLatest News on CryptomemoryNCCLNvidiaSB Crypto Guru Newsunveils
Previous Post

Bingx Resumes ‘Mainstream’ Asset Withdrawals 24 Hours After Hack

Next Post

Crypto Whales Buy $228 Million In XRP Following $5 Price Prediction

Related Posts

NVIDIA Integrates CUDA Tile Backend for OpenAI Triton GPU Programming

NVIDIA Integrates CUDA Tile Backend for OpenAI Triton GPU Programming

by SB Crypto Guru News
January 30, 2026
0

Alvin Lang Jan 30, 2026 20:12 NVIDIA's new CUDA Tile IR backend for OpenAI Triton enables Python developers to access...

TON Price Prediction: Targets .00-.40 Recovery by February 2026

TON Price Prediction: Targets $2.00-$2.40 Recovery by February 2026

by SB Crypto Guru News
January 30, 2026
0

Iris Coleman Jan 30, 2026 11:05 Toncoin trades at $1.44 with oversold RSI at 32.92. Multiple analysts target $2.00-$2.40 recovery...

How DePIN Crypto is Revolutionizing Infrastructure in Web3?

How DePIN Crypto is Revolutionizing Infrastructure in Web3?

by SB Crypto Guru News
January 30, 2026
0

The growing scale of innovation in the domain of blockchain and web3 has brought the limelight on DePIN crypto projects....

Hong Kong to Issue HK.5B in HONIA-Indexed Infrastructure Bonds

Hong Kong to Issue HK$1.5B in HONIA-Indexed Infrastructure Bonds

by SB Crypto Guru News
January 29, 2026
0

Darius Baruo Jan 29, 2026 11:01 HKMA announces February 4 tender for floating rate notes tied to overnight index average,...

How Financial Services Can Build Trust Using Blockchain

How Financial Services Can Build Trust Using Blockchain

by SB Crypto Guru News
January 28, 2026
0

The apprehensions regarding trust continue to dominate most of the concerns associated with adoption of new technologies like blockchain. Blockchain...

Load More
Next Post
Crypto Whales Buy 8 Million In XRP Following  Price Prediction

Crypto Whales Buy $228 Million In XRP Following $5 Price Prediction

Shiba Inu Eyes Major Rally As Metrics Turn Bullish, Can Price Touch alt=

Shiba Inu Eyes Major Rally As Metrics Turn Bullish, Can Price Touch $0.00004?

Facebook Twitter LinkedIn Tumblr RSS

CATEGORIES

  • Altcoin
  • Analysis
  • Bitcoin
  • Blockchain
  • Crypto Exchanges
  • Crypto Updates
  • DeFi
  • Ethereum
  • Metaverse
  • Mining
  • NFT
  • Regulations
  • Scam Alert
  • Uncategorized
  • Web3

SITE MAP

  • Disclaimer
  • Privacy Policy
  • DMCA
  • Cookie Privacy Policy
  • Terms and Conditions
  • Contact us

Copyright © 2022 - SB Crypto Guru News.
SB Crypto Guru News is not responsible for the content of external sites.

Welcome Back!

Login to your account below

Forgotten Password?

Retrieve your password

Please enter your username or email address to reset your password.

Log In
No Result
View All Result
  • HOME
  • BITCOIN
  • CRYPTO UPDATES
    • GENERAL
    • ALTCOINS
    • ETHEREUM
    • CRYPTO EXCHANGES
    • CRYPTO MINING
  • BLOCKCHAIN
  • NFT
  • DEFI
  • WEB3
  • METAVERSE
  • REGULATIONS
  • SCAM ALERT
  • ANALYSIS

Copyright © 2022 - SB Crypto Guru News.
SB Crypto Guru News is not responsible for the content of external sites.